Fulham DFC Pre-Season Schedule
It is now three weeks into pre-season, FDFC Managers Ayad Sarraf and Ivan Stone have both been impressed by the huge turnouts for pre-season, and work rate shown by everyone. Over the next few weeks both managers will be selecting their final squads for the new season, and will use the upcoming fixtures to fine tune the squads in time for the start of the season on September 1st.
Next week we will hear from managers Ayad and Ivan, regarding pre-season, new signings and their outlook for the new season, and we will also hear from our internationals regarding their experiences in the European Deaf Football Championships, which saw Great Britain, consisting of Ayad Sarraf, Ben Lampert, Greg Beedie and Mark Gill win Silver, losing out to France 1-2 in the final. Bryan Moore’s Ireland defeated Germany to win bronze in the play off after losing to Great Britain in the semi final.

Fulham DFC Head Coach Mark Saunderson, and physio Lorraine Swindlehurst were also part of the backroom team for Great Britain at the European Championships which took place in Lisbon, Portugal.
